Photoshop CC 2017 Shape cutouts

I have discovered that the directions for creating cookie cutter cutouts from the shape tool have changed in version 2017.  Can someone explain how I can cutout a shape, like a heart, from an image and save it as a new document?

How are you making your shape?  It's the same as it was essentually

Start with path options set to Combine Shapes and make your first path

Hit the Escape key to end that process

Change Path Options to Subtract, and make the hole.
